Any California-based business or public official requiring a surety bond may complete the Commercial Surety Application. Ensure that you have all necessary documentation and information ready before applying.
While there are no universal deadlines, it is crucial to submit your application as soon as possible to allow for processing, especially if you are nearing a bond requirement for specific contracts or positions.
You can submit the completed application electronically through pdfFiller. After finalizing your form, follow the submission prompts to send it directly to the necessary parties.
Typically, supporting documents may include proof of business registration, financial statements, and any other information outlined in the form instructions. Gather these documents ahead of time for a smoother application process.
Ensure all fields are accurately filled and that you've signed where required. Common mistakes include leaving fields blank or providing incorrect information, which can delay bond issuance.
Processing times can vary, but it generally takes a few days to a couple of weeks. For faster service, complete your application accurately and ensure all required documents are submitted.
No, the Commercial Surety Application does not require notarization. However, ensure that all signatures are properly included to facilitate bond issuance.
